Session_End and Session.Abandon

Session_End and Session.Abandon

    Say, for example you call a Session.Abandon on a logout page. Does the Session_End in the Global.asax fire before or after the Session variables are destroyed?

    No. Session_End will not fire while using the Session.Abandon Method . Session_End will fire only the session timeout.<BR><BR><BR>The Abandon method destroys all the objects stored in a Session object and releases their resources. If you do not call the Abandon method explicitly, the server destroys these objects when the session times out.

